网站搭建全攻略:高效框架与性能优化指南
|
在当今数字化时代,一个高效、稳定的网站已成为企业与个人展示形象的重要窗口。无论是博客、电商平台还是企业官网,网站的搭建质量直接影响用户体验与转化效果。选择合适的开发框架是成功的第一步,它决定了项目架构的清晰度与后期维护的便捷性。 目前主流的前端框架如React、Vue和Angular各具优势。React以组件化思想为核心,拥有庞大的生态系统,适合构建复杂交互界面;Vue则以轻量简洁著称,学习曲线平缓,特别适合中小型项目快速上手;Angular作为全功能框架,提供了完整的解决方案,适用于大型企业级应用。根据项目规模与团队技术背景合理选型,能显著提升开发效率。 后端方面,Node.js凭借其异步非阻塞特性,成为构建高性能服务的理想选择。Express和NestJS是其中的佼佼者。Express轻量灵活,适合快速原型开发;NestJS基于TypeScript,采用模块化设计,结构清晰,更适合长期维护的中大型系统。搭配数据库如MySQL、PostgreSQL或MongoDB,可实现数据的高效读写与管理。
AI绘图结果,仅供参考 网站性能优化是决定用户留存的关键环节。首屏加载速度直接影响用户跳出率。通过代码分割(Code Splitting)与懒加载(Lazy Loading),可减少初始资源体积,仅在需要时加载相应模块。同时,使用CDN(内容分发网络)将静态资源部署至全球节点,能有效降低延迟,提升访问速度。图片与视频资源是网页体积的主要来源。采用WebP格式替代传统JPEG/PNG,可在保持画质的同时大幅压缩文件大小。对于动态内容,可启用响应式图片(srcset)适配不同设备分辨率。合理设置缓存策略,利用浏览器缓存与服务端缓存机制,避免重复请求,进一步加快页面响应。 代码层面的优化同样不可忽视。压缩与混淆JavaScript、CSS文件,移除无用代码(Tree Shaking),能有效减小包体积。避免在关键路径上执行同步操作,确保主线程不被阻塞。使用现代浏览器支持的API如Intersection Observer,可实现更高效的滚动监听与懒加载逻辑。 部署阶段也需注重稳定性与可扩展性。推荐使用Docker容器化部署,统一环境配置,减少“在我机器上能跑”的问题。结合CI/CD工具链(如GitHub Actions、Jenkins),实现自动化测试与发布流程,提升交付效率。上线后,通过监控工具(如Sentry、Prometheus)实时追踪错误与性能指标,及时发现问题并修复。 网站搭建并非一蹴而就,而是持续迭代的过程。从框架选型到性能调优,每一步都需兼顾可维护性与用户体验。掌握核心原则,善用工具,才能打造出既高效又稳定的数字门户。真正的优秀网站,不仅看得见,更感受得到。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

